These players WILL play in a bo5 tiebreaker bracket, taking place between the end of the Gen 9 Open and the start of the playoffs, to determine final playoffs seeding.
Tiebreaker matchups will be determined by ranked choice. Each round, competitors will rank their top 5 Opens (not formats—so, for example, “Gameboy Classic” rather than “Gen 2”), then share that ranking privately with hosts (
Javi and myself;
Fragments has stepped down as Slam III host, and we thank him for his service! <3). From those submitted rankings, the top 3 Opens from the higher seed, and top 2 from the lower seed (as determined by win%), will be chosen, in alternating order, and announced; in the event of ties/repeats, the next Open on the respective player’s ranking will be chosen. No repeats are allowed.
Once the 5 Opens for each series have been determined, players will battle. The higher seed will pick from among the 5 Opens for game 1, and loser picks afterward. The first player to 3 wins advances to the next round.
